Asia-Pacific Food Flavors Market Segmentation and Market Companies
Segments
- Based on type, the Asia-Pacific food flavors market can be segmented into natural flavors and artificial flavors. Natural flavors are derived from natural sources like fruits, vegetables, spices, and herbs, providing a clean label appeal to the products. Artificial flavors, on the other hand, are synthesized in a laboratory to mimic natural flavors, offering a cost-effective alternative to natural flavors.
- By application, the market can be categorized into beverages, dairy & frozen products, bakery & confectionery, savory & snacks, and others. Beverages segment is expected to witness significant growth due to the rising demand for flavored drinks among consumers.
- On the basis of form, the market can be divided into liquid, powder, and paste. The liquid form is widely used in the food and beverage industry as it offers ease of incorporation and uniform mixing in the products.
- Looking at the flavor type, the market is segmented into savory flavors, sweet flavors, fruity flavors, and others. The sweet flavors segment dominates the market share owing to the popularity of sweet products among consumers in the Asia-Pacific region.

The Asia-Pacific food flavors market continues to witness signific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for natural flavors as consumers prioritize clean label products. With a focus on health and wellness, manufacturers are shifting towards using natural flavors derived from fruits, vegetables, and herbs to meet consumer preferences. This shift towards natural flavors is also attributed to the rising awareness among consumers regarding the health benefits of consuming products with clean labels. Additionally, artificial flavors are gaining traction in the market as a cost-effective alternative to natural flavors, especially in price-sensitive segments.
In terms of applications, the beverages segment is expected to experience substantial growth in the Asia-Pacific food flavors market. The increasing consumer preference for flavored drinks, including functional beverages and ready-to-drink products, is driving the demand for a variety of flavors in the beverages segment. Manufacturers are focusing on developing innovative flavor profiles to cater to the evolving preferences of consumers and enhance the sensory experience of their products. Furthermore, the bakery & confectionery segment is also witnessing steady growth, driven by the popularity of indulgence products and the continuous introduction of novel flavor combinations.
The form of food flavors plays a crucial role in their usage across various food and beverage products. The liquid form of flavors is widely preferred in the industry due to its ease of incorporation and efficient mixing properties. Liquid flavors offer manufacturers flexibility in application, enabling homogeneous distribution across the end products. Moreover, the paste and powder forms of flavors are also gaining traction, especially in products where a concentrated flavor profile is required. These different forms of food flavors cater to diverse manufacturing requirements, allowing manufacturers to create products with distinct flavor profiles.
When analyzing the flavor types dominating the Asia-Pacific food flavors market, sweet flavors emerge as the most popular among consumers in the region. The preference for sweet products, including desserts, candies, and beverages, drives the demand for a wide range of sweet flavors. Manufacturers are introducing innovative sweet flavor profiles to differentiate their products in the market and meet the growing demand for indulgent and flavorful offerings. Additionally, savory flavors and fruity flavors also hold significant market shares, reflecting the diverse taste preferences of consumers across various product categories.
